I have a 2001 Celica GT (not even GTS) and as a 23 yr old female with a 100% clean driving record with no accident history or tickets, the cheapest I could find was to stay under my parents with multiple discounts and pay $430/6 months. It's obscene since it's a 10 yr old 4 cylinder 140 hp car but insurance companies claim it's a "sports car". No. A Porsche is a sports car, not this.
When I purchased it at age 19, I was paying $900/6 months. This has all been with American Family Insurance. The insurance quoter told me I should be thankful I wasn't a guy since it would have been $1600, yes SIXTEEN HUNDRED every 6 months. Thats roughly the same cost for an adult male to insure a $100K brand new Mercedes SL.
I truly suggest you shop around for insurance A LOT and make sure a Celica is an economical option for you. I love my car to death but this insurance cost is the worst!
